This is a 8514 square foot, apartment home. This home is located at 611 Westhoff Ave, O'Fallon, MO 63366.
Off market
Street View
$466,364
611 Westhoff Ave, O'Fallon, MO 63366
--beds
--baths
8,514sqft
Apartment
Built in 1980
-- sqft lot
$-- Zestimate®
$55/sqft
$1,537 Estimated rent